Lesson from Little One
Yesterday evening, my wife and I visited the site where we're planning to build our new house. You see, our current house will be affected by the Pan Borneo Highway project. It's such a mix of emotions—sadness, anger, and everything in between. After 11 years of living in our home, it's heartbreaking to think about it being torn down.
At the site, there’s a small pineapple patch. We found this tiny pineapple, about the size of a fist, and honestly, it looked so adorable. It was a little bright spot on an otherwise gloomy evening.
No matter what happens, we have to keep our spirits high and move forward. This little pineapple feels like a symbol of hope. Even when life turns everything upside down, something sweet and good can still grow.
